The Old Duke
The Old Duke, named after legendary musician Duke Ellington, is Bristol's home of live jazz. Jazz is not, however, The Old Duke's only winning attraction. The outdoor seating makes it perfect for the two lazy summer evenings we get every year, and their wide selection of spirits (yes, boys and girls, we've spent a night on the absinthe here, and yes, it is in fact the devil's own piss) goes to further prove why time spent in the Old Duke makes for an excellent night on the tiles (and one hell of a liver-twistingly painful morning after).
